Output 0c1c630aa89687fd730aea6aecbc5b08a8c5748aab37cb13e7dbe558336056d8:1

value
20261833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d29a5c2076d6bf163558bc3588ec8fb9e933b4c OP_EQUAL
address
34MDQppaEvR89HkmBa3NFsCbp4CwCpzUvF
transaction
0c1c630aa89687fd730aea6aecbc5b08a8c5748aab37cb13e7dbe558336056d8
confirmations
289955
spent
true